96
Wine Advocate
“Composed of 72% Cabernet Sauvignon, 19% Merlot, 6% Cabernet Franc and 3% Petit Verdot, the 2018 Lynch-Bages was aged in 75% new barriques. Deep garnet-purple in color, it soars out of the glass with a magnificently expressive nose of blueberry compote, black cherry preserves and blackcurrant pastilles, plus suggestions of dark chocolate, licorice, tar and violets with a waft of hoisin. The medium to full-bodied palate is just as impactful as the nose, coating the mouth with juicy black berry and spicy layers, supported by firm, grainy tannins and seamless freshness, finishing long with a refreshing earthiness coming through at the end. (LPB)” (03/2021)

N/A
Jancis Robinson
“72% Cabernet Sauvignon, 19% Merlot, 6% Cabernet Franc and 3% Petit Verdot. Aged for 18 months in oak barrels (75% new). Deep purple-black hue. Big, powerful and brooding. Riper style with an almost raisined edge to the fruit but freshness as well so there’s balance. Substantial weight of fruit on the palate with big, punchy tannins. Muscular and assertive but clear potential. (JL)” (02/2025)
